Job Title: KS2 Teacher - Opportunities Across Newport
Location: Newport
Start Date: September 2025
Contract Type: Full-time, Long-term
Pay: 166.32 - 240 per day (depending on teacher pay scale)

About the Roles:
Academics are seeking Key Stage 2 teachers for long-term placements starting in September 2025.

There are a variety of roles available across Years 3 to 6, offering flexibility to suit your strengths and experience - from class teaching positions to more targeted support roles.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Plan and deliver engaging lessons tailored to the KS2 curriculum
  • Support and assess pupil progress, adapting your teaching where needed
  • Foster a positive, inclusive, and well-managed learning environment
  • Work collaboratively with colleagues, parents, and the wider school community

Requirements:

  •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) or equivalent
  • Experience teaching within Key Stage 2
  • Strong classroom management and behaviour strategies
  • Enhanced DBS on the Update Service (or willingness to apply)
